        In today's world, many organizations with low profits, limited capital and intensive competition, and at the same time must meet the endorsements of shareholders, are successful organizations that can create better opportunities and create new opportunities. Given the importance of knowledge and its pivotal role in the knowledge age, organizations, especially knowledge-based organizations, whose knowledge is a strategic source and a key factor in acquiring and maintaining the core competence of the organization, is essential for establishing knowledge management and identifying obstacles. Thought ahead with implementation with a systematic approach to develop the capabilities that lead to the development of knowledge as a key source of enterprise. In order to achieve this goal, a knowledge-based knowledge-based airspace-based knowledge management organization was considered and a system model was mapped out. At first, various factors that can be effective were identified through questionnaires and interviews and literature reviews. Then, the causal and impulsive diagrams, which are one of the tools used in the dynamics dynamics methodology, were drawn and finally, these factors were prioritized using the fuzzy dematerial method and the effective and effective factors were identified. The rate of knowledge sharing, the number of human resources with a high level of knowledge and experience, the quality of individual work of the staff, the culture of sharing knowledge and the level of attention of senior executives to the IT infrastructure were the five most important and important factors. These factors were used as the basis for developing knowledge management strategies in the organization in order to achieve effective strategic strategies.         Knowledge management is the process of creating, sharing, using and managing knowledge of an organization. A knowledge management system is known as a knowledge base and is a comprehensive system that can provide many methods for providing documentation. The knowledge management system is a platform that covers the organization's collective knowledge and creates a centralized repository for storing and accessing the organization's activities. organizations do this through a tool or software specifically designed for knowledge management. Knowledge management systems refer to a class of information systems applied to organizational knowledge management and have been developed to support and promote organizational processes of creating, storing, retrieving, transferring and applying knowledge, in the company's organizational workplace. Various categories of knowledge management systems have been presented in articles. In this article, the main principles of knowledge management have been extracted with a new approach. For this purpose, first the main life cycle activities have been identified. Then, by reviewing conventional knowledge management systems and brainstorming sessions, the main services have been identified. Finally by applying clustering on the extracted services based on the k-means algorithm, the services have been clustered and the main systems have been extracted. In order to evaluate the quality of extraction systems, we have benefited experts, and experts in the field of knowledge management evaluated the quality of extraction systems at an optimal level. It is expected that by implementing these systems in different industries, it will be possible to help spread knowledge management in the industry as much as possible. Manuscript profile
